The crypto types are useful to use in other components that are
separate from the radicle crate, e.g. the incoming radicle-cobs
crate.
Separate out the types into a radicle-crypto crate. This crate defines
the usual PublicKey, SecretKey, and Signature types. It also provides
the ssh functionality, under the `ssh` feature. It is also necessary
to provide the `From` impl for `Component` here, which again is
guarded by the `git-ref-format` feature.
The `Arbitrary` implementation are moved. The arbitrary decision of
redefining `ByteArray` in both radicle-crypto and radicle was made.

The changes in this commit are all intertwined and it was hard to
split them into smaller commits:
* Use custom transports everywhere
Instead of `file://` and instead of using a child process for fetching
and pushing; we go through our custom transports, which use the `rad://`
and `heartwood://` schemes.
* Introduce a 'mock' remote transport
To test the remote transport without needing to spawn TCP streams,
we add a mock transport that works between storages on the file
system.
* Get rid of node's `git-url`
Instead of git urls, nodes simply use their node-ids to replicate.
